Panduan Lengkap untuk Konfigurasi SSH ke Keamanan Server



Dalam lanskap digital saat ini, menyediakan akses ke jarak jauh ke server dan perangkat jaringan adalah prioritas penting bagi tim bisnis dan TI. Telnet (TNET) adalah pilihan yang populer untuk mengakses perangkat panjang, tetapi kurangnya enkripsi membuat data sensitif rentan terhadap persimpangan. Gunakan Secure Shell (SSH), protokol jaringan kriptografi yang dirancang untuk melindungi koneksi enkripsi Anda yang kuat, untuk memastikan keamanan data dan kredensial penting. Artikel ini membahas dasar -dasar SSH, menjelaskan keunggulannya dibandingkan dengan telnet, proses konfigurasi dan gagasan mekanisme keamanan dasar.

Apa itu ssh dan mengapa ini penting?

SSH (Secure Shell) adalah protokol kriptografi yang memungkinkan pengguna mengakses perangkat jaringan dengan aman. Dengan mengenkripsi komunikasi antara klien dan server, SSH memastikan bahwa data sensitif, termasuk data perintah entri dan konfigurasi, tidak dapat terjebak atau dibaca oleh pihak yang tidak sah. Protokol ini berfungsi Port 22 dan secara luas dianggap sebagai standar industri untuk hubungan jarak jauh yang aman.

Apa yang membedakan SSH dari telnet?

Telnet, meskipun dapat terjadi dari jauh, mengirimkan data dalam bentuk teks biasa, sehingga sangat rentan terhadap penangkapan pelaku kejahatan. SSH mengatasi kerentanan ini dengan menggunakan algoritma enkripsi seperti RSA (adopsi-Rivest-Shamir-Adleman) untuk melindungi data yang dikirim. Berikut ini adalah perbandingan singkat:

  • EnkripsiTelnet tidak memiliki enkripsi sementara SSH mengenkripsi semua data yang dikirim.
  • Nomor gerbang: Telnet menggunakan port 23; SSH menggunakan port 22.
  • KeamananKoneksi telnet dapat dilihat di alat -alat seperti Wireshark, yang memungkinkan penyerang untuk menangkap kata sandi dan perintah. SSH mengenkripsi komunikasi ini sehingga penangkapannya sia -sia.

Singkatnya, Telnet mungkin masih memiliki penggunaan terbatas untuk jaringan internal, tetapi SSH adalah solusi yang lebih disukai untuk menyediakan koneksi internet atau di lingkungan risiko tinggi.

Panduan langkah demi langkah untuk mengonfigurasi ssh

Mengkonfigurasi SSH pada perangkat jaringan seperti router yang melibatkan beberapa langkah. Setiap langkah menjamin keamanan dan fungsionalitas koneksi, sehingga siap untuk aplikasi di dunia nyata.

Langkah 1: Atur nama host

Pertama, satu set tidak a ke perangkat. Nama host adalah komponen kunci saat membuat kunci enkripsi yang diperlukan untuk komunikasi yang aman.

nama host R1 

Langkah 2: Tetapkan nama domain

Lalu tentukan a Domain untuk perangkat. Ini, dikombinasikan dengan nama host, digunakan untuk membuat kunci enkripsi RSA.

contoh nama domain ip.com 

Langkah 3: Siapkan Kunci RSA

SSH mengandalkan enkripsi RSA untuk menyediakan komunikasi. Gunakan perintah berikut untuk membuat kunci RSA:

pembangkit kunci kripto rsa 

Sistem ini akan meminta Anda untuk menentukan ukuran kunci dalam bit (mis. 512, 1024, 2048 atau 4096). Kunci yang lebih besar menawarkan enkripsi yang lebih kuat, tetapi dapat mempengaruhi produktivitas karena peningkatan ukuran paket. Pilihan totalnya adalah 1024 bityang menyeimbangkan keamanan dan efisiensi.

Langkah 4: Buat nama pengguna dan kata sandi

Tentukan nama pengguna dan kata sandi otentikasi lokal. Langkah ini menjamin bahwa hanya pengguna yang berwenang yang dapat mengakses perangkat.

nama pengguna admin kata sandi securepassword 

Langkah 5: Mengkonfigurasi jalur terminal virtual (VTY)

VTTY ROAD mengontrol akses jarak jauh ke perangkat. Konfigurasikan waktu ini untuk mengaktifkan SSH dan membatasi protokol lain (misalnya telnet).

baris vty 0 4 login transportasi lokal masukan ssh 

Di Sini:

  • baris vty 0 4 Izinkan 5 Tautan SimultanS
  • masuk lokal Menginformasikan perangkat untuk menggunakan database pada nama pengguna/kata sandi lokal.
  • masukan transportasi ssh Tentukan bahwa hanya koneksi SSH yang diizinkan.

Langkah 6: Aktifkan kata sandi mode khusus

Akhirnya, atur Aktifkan rahasia Kata sandi untuk memberikan akses khusus ke perangkat.

aktifkan kata sandi rahasia yang kuat 

Periksa konfigurasinya

Setelah Anda menyelesaikan pengaturan, periksa apakah SSH berfungsi dengan baik. Gunakan perintah berikut untuk memeriksa detailnya:

  • Tunjukkan konfigurasi SSH saat ini:
    tampilkan ssh 
  • Daftar Pengguna Terkait:
    menunjukkan pengguna 

Perintah ini menunjukkan koneksi SSH yang aktif dan mengonfirmasi bahwa konfigurasi Anda berfungsi.

Bagaimana SSH melindungi data dengan aman

Pada dasarnya, SSH menggunakan enkripsi untuk memastikan kerahasiaan dan integritas data klien dan server. Begini cara kerjanya:

  1. Kunci: Ketika pelanggan memulai koneksi, server mengirim kunci publik ke klien.
  2. Perjanjian kunci untuk suatu sesi: Pelanggan dan server setuju Sesi Kunciyang digunakan untuk mengenkripsi data.
  3. Verifikasi: Klien mengelola dirinya sendiri menggunakan Nama pengguna/kata sandi atau a kunciS
  4. Enkripsi: Setelah disertifikasi, semua data yang dikirim antara klien dan server dienkripsi menggunakan kunci sesi.

Dengan menggunakan proses ini, SSH memastikan bahwa meskipun paket data dicegat, informasi tersebut tidak dapat dipahami oleh pengguna yang tidak sah.

Aplikasi SSH di dunia nyata

SSH adalah protokol multifungsi yang digunakan dalam berbagai skenario, selain hanya mengakses router atau sakelar. Beberapa aplikasi di dunia nyata meliputi:

  • Akses ke agen cloud: SSH penting untuk mengelola mesin virtual (VM) dari platform seperti AWS, Azure dan Google Cloud.
  • Transfer file Aman: Menggunakan instrumen sebagai Indonesia: SFTP (Secure File Transfer Protocol), SSH memungkinkan untuk mengunggah yang aman dan mengunduh file.
  • Tugas otomatis: Tim pengembang dan TI menggunakan SSH untuk memulai skrip dan mengotomatiskan server panjang.
  • Administrasi Jaringan: SSH memungkinkan administrator untuk memecahkan masalah, mengkonfigurasi, dan memantau perangkat dengan aman.

Poin utama

  • SSH penting untuk keamanan: Tidak seperti Telnet, SSH mengenkripsi semua komunikasi, menjadikannya standar industri untuk akses yang aman ke jarak.
  • Konfigurasi: Persiapan SSH yang melibatkan langkah -langkah sederhana seperti mengatur nama host, membuat kunci RSA dan mengkonfigurasi jalan vty.
  • RSA adalah tulang belakangnyaEnkripsi RSA memberikan kerahasiaan data menggunakan kombinasi kunci publik dan pribadi.
  • Kasus penggunaan multifungsi: Dari manajemen server cloud ke transfer file, SSH adalah alat penting bagi para profesional TI.
  • Verifikasi Konfigurasi: Selalu uji pengaturan SSH Anda menggunakan perintah sebagai tampilkan ssh Dan menunjukkan pengguna Untuk memastikan semuanya berfungsi seperti yang diharapkan.
  • Telnet sudah ketinggalan zaman: Hindari menggunakan telnet untuk koneksi eksternal atau sensitif karena kurangnya enkripsi.

Kesimpulan

SSH adalah teknologi utama untuk menangani perangkat jarak yang aman. Kemampuan terenkripsi yang kuat, kemudahan konfigurasi dan fleksibilitas membuatnya sangat penting bagi tim TI, pengembang, dan pemilik bisnis. Mengikuti langkah -langkah dan praktik terbaik yang dijelaskan, Anda dapat mengonfirmasi bahwa Anda menerapkan SSH untuk melindungi perangkat dan sistem jaringan Anda, menjamin keamanan dan ketenangan di era digital saat ini. Sebagai kemajuan Anda dalam perjalanan teknis, menguasai SSH akan menjadi keterampilan penting yang mendasari kemampuan Anda untuk mengelola dan menyediakan infrastruktur TI yang kompleks.

Sumber: “Panduan Lengkap: Cara Mengkonfigurasi SSH dan Meningkatkan Keamanan Server” – Raja Jaringan, YouTube, 22 Agustus 2025 –

Penggunaan: Dipaku untuk referensi. Kutipan pendek digunakan untuk komentar/ulasan.

Artikel blog terkait



Teknologi Terkini

Jasa PBN

Leave a Reply

Your email address will not be published. Required fields are marked *